About Raphael's School of Beauty Culture Inc-Boardman

Raphael's School of Beauty Culture Inc-Boardman is a private for-profit trade school in Boardman, Ohio, enrolling about 129 students. Programs focus on certificates and workforce credentials that prepare students for skilled trades and technical careers. The published completion rate is about 57.69% at 150% of normal time. Median earnings about ten years after entry reach about $22,437 among students who received federal aid.

Student body

Enrollment & Student Demographics

Raphael's School of Beauty Culture Inc-Boardman reported total enrollment of about 129 students in the latest College Scorecard extract. The student body is about 5% male and 95% female. Enrollment by race and ethnicity includes White (67.4%), Black or African American (20.2%), and Two or More Races (8.5%). About 55.02% of undergraduates receive Pell Grants. Roughly 48.5% of students are first-generation college students.
